AFRICA/IVORY COAST - “LOST YOUTH COMBAT NAMES COSA NOSTRA AND MAFIA ”…SAYS MISSIONARY WHO CRITICISES BEHAVIOUR OF FRANCE IN THIS TRAGEDY

Tuesday, 20 May 2003

Abidjan (Fides Service) – “This is not yet authentic peace” a Comboni Missionary in Ivory Coast tells Fides Service. That country has been in the grip of ferocious civil war since September last year. “Despite the formation of a government of national unity with the participation of representatives of all the parties and rebel movements, there seems to be no way out of the spiral of violence” the missionary adds “not only has the problem of the appointment of ministers of defence and security yet to be solved but all sides, government and rebels, continue to preach hatred instead of looking for paths to peace”.
Moreover divisions in the rebel camps are beginning to appear: “The main rebel group Patriotic Movement of Ivory Coast MPCI, has split” the local source tells Fides Service “on the one hand there is Koonate the chief and on the other, other leaders who want to kill him. In MPCI controlled areas there is constant shooting between the two factions. The presence of Liberian mercenaries paid both by government and guerrilla adds to the confusion, because often these soldiers are totally undisciplined and think of plundering among the civilians ”.
With regard to international responsibility the missionary says: “Certainly France is also responsible for what is happening here. President Gbagbo was a protege of the socialist Jospin. When the former lost the presidential elections France’s protection of the Ivorian president was withdrawn and suddenly a civil war broke out. Gbagbo also opened Ivory Coast to Asian investments (China, India) damaging the interests of French industries in the country and creating another reason for friction with Paris”.
The missionary adds: “Ivory Coast is losing a whole new generation in this absurd war. It is heartbreaking to see young men become prey to the culture of violence. This is seen also by the names taken by the different combat units: Cosa Nostra, Cobra, Mafia. Almost a following of negative myths of a certain type of western cinema”.
